disallow的含义
作者:甘肃知识解读网
|
89人看过
发布时间:2026-04-08 14:39:44
标签:disallow
disallow 的含义与使用详解在互联网和网页开发中,disallow 是一个非常重要的关键词,尤其在搜索引擎优化(SEO)和网站规则设置中占据核心地位。它主要用于控制网页内容的访问权限,例如限制某些页面或资源的访问,或在搜
disallow 的含义与使用详解
在互联网和网页开发中,disallow 是一个非常重要的关键词,尤其在搜索引擎优化(SEO)和网站规则设置中占据核心地位。它主要用于控制网页内容的访问权限,例如限制某些页面或资源的访问,或在搜索引擎中排除某些内容。本文将从定义、使用场景、技术实现、SEO 意义、实际案例等多个角度,深入解析 disallow 的含义与应用。
一、disallow 的基本定义
disallow 的基本含义是“禁止”,在不同的语境中,其含义也有所不同。在网页开发中,它通常用于设置服务器规则,禁止某些页面或资源被访问。在搜索引擎优化中,它用于指示搜索引擎排除某些页面内容,避免其被收录或排名下降。
在技术术语中,disallow 通常指“禁止访问”或“禁止索引”。它常用于服务器配置文件(如 `.htaccess` 文件)中,用于控制网页内容的访问权限。
二、disallow 在网页开发中的应用
在网页开发中,disallow 通常用于设置服务器规则,控制网页内容的访问权限。例如,在 `.htaccess` 文件中,可以使用以下语法:
Disallow /old-page/
这表示禁止访问 `/old-page/` 以下所有页面。
在网页开发中,disallow 还可用于设置 URL 重定向规则,例如:
Redirect 301 /old-page/ http://new-domain.com/
这表示将 `/old-page/` 重定向到新域名。
此外,在前端开发中,disallow 也用于限制用户访问某些页面,例如:
if (userIsNotAdmin)
disallowAccessToPage('/admin');
这表示在用户不是管理员的情况下,禁止访问 `/admin` 页面。
三、disallow 在搜索引擎优化(SEO)中的作用
在 SEO 中,disallow 用于控制搜索引擎是否收录某些网页内容。例如,在网站的 `.htaccess` 文件中,可以设置:
RewriteRule ^old-page$ /new-page/ [R=301,L]
这表示将 `/old-page/` 重定向到 `/new-page/`,同时禁止搜索引擎收录 `/old-page/` 页面。
另外,在搜索引擎优化中,disallow 也用于排除某些页面,避免其被收录。例如:
Disallow /deprecated/
这表示禁止收录 `/deprecated/` 以下所有页面。
四、disallow 的技术实现方式
在技术实现中,disallow 通常通过服务器配置文件(如 `.htaccess` 或 `robots.txt` 文件)来设置。在 `.htaccess` 文件中,可以使用以下语法:
Disallow /old-page/
这表示禁止访问 `/old-page/` 以下所有页面。
在 `robots.txt` 文件中,可以设置:
User-agent:
Disallow: /old-page/
这表示所有搜索引擎都禁止访问 `/old-page/` 页面。
此外,在前端开发中,disallow 也可以通过 JavaScript 或服务器端代码实现。例如,在服务器端,可以使用如下的伪代码:
if (request.path == '/old-page/')
disallowAccessToPage('/old-page/');
这表示在用户访问 `/old-page/` 时,禁止访问该页面。
五、disallow 在 SEO 中的实际应用
在 SEO 中,disallow 用于控制搜索引擎是否收录某些网页内容。例如,在网站的 `.htaccess` 文件中,可以设置:
RewriteRule ^old-page$ /new-page/ [R=301,L]
这表示将 `/old-page/` 重定向到 `/new-page/`,同时禁止搜索引擎收录 `/old-page/` 页面。
此外,在 SEO 中,disallow 也用于排除某些页面,避免其被收录。例如:
Disallow /deprecated/
这表示禁止收录 `/deprecated/` 以下所有页面。
六、disallow 的实际应用场景
在实际应用中,disallow 广泛用于以下几个场景:
1. 网页开发:设置服务器规则,控制网页内容的访问权限。
2. SEO 优化:排除某些页面,避免其被收录。
3. 网站维护:清理旧页面,避免重复内容。
4. 用户体验:限制用户访问某些页面,提升网站安全性。
例如,一个电商网站可能会设置:
Disallow /old-products/
以禁止搜索引擎收录旧的促销页面,避免影响搜索排名。
七、disallow 的常见误区与注意事项
在使用 disallow 时,需要注意以下几个常见误区:
1. 误用路径:在设置 `Disallow` 时,路径必须准确无误,否则会导致页面被错误地排除。
2. 忽略重定向:在设置 `Disallow` 时,需注意重定向规则,避免因重定向导致页面被错误排除。
3. 忽略权限控制:在网页开发中,`Disallow` 不能替代权限控制,应结合前端 JavaScript 或服务器端代码进行管理。
4. 忽略 SEO 优化:在 SEO 优化中,`Disallow` 只是控制搜索引擎的手段,不能替代内容质量的提升。
八、disallow 的未来发展趋势
随着互联网技术的发展,disallow 在网页开发、SEO 优化和网站维护中仍将发挥重要作用。未来,随着人工智能和自动化工具的普及,disallow 的使用将更加智能化,例如:
- 自动识别并排除重复内容
- 智能推荐排除页面
- 通过机器学习优化搜索引擎的收录策略
同时,随着用户隐私和数据安全的提升,disallow 也将更多地用于数据保护和内容过滤,防止敏感信息被滥用。
九、总结
disallow 是一个重要的技术术语,广泛应用于网页开发、SEO 优化和网站维护中。它在控制网页访问权限、排除搜索引擎收录和提升用户体验等方面发挥着关键作用。在实际应用中,需要注意路径的准确性、重定向规则的设置以及权限控制的结合使用。随着技术的发展,disallow 将继续在互联网领域中扮演重要角色。
十、
在互联网时代,disallow 是一个不可或缺的关键词。无论是网页开发、SEO 优化,还是网站维护,它都扮演着重要的角色。通过合理使用 disallow,可以提升网站的用户体验、优化搜索引擎排名,同时确保网站的安全性和稳定性。在未来,随着技术的不断进步,disallow 的应用将更加广泛和深入。
在互联网和网页开发中,disallow 是一个非常重要的关键词,尤其在搜索引擎优化(SEO)和网站规则设置中占据核心地位。它主要用于控制网页内容的访问权限,例如限制某些页面或资源的访问,或在搜索引擎中排除某些内容。本文将从定义、使用场景、技术实现、SEO 意义、实际案例等多个角度,深入解析 disallow 的含义与应用。
一、disallow 的基本定义
disallow 的基本含义是“禁止”,在不同的语境中,其含义也有所不同。在网页开发中,它通常用于设置服务器规则,禁止某些页面或资源被访问。在搜索引擎优化中,它用于指示搜索引擎排除某些页面内容,避免其被收录或排名下降。
在技术术语中,disallow 通常指“禁止访问”或“禁止索引”。它常用于服务器配置文件(如 `.htaccess` 文件)中,用于控制网页内容的访问权限。
二、disallow 在网页开发中的应用
在网页开发中,disallow 通常用于设置服务器规则,控制网页内容的访问权限。例如,在 `.htaccess` 文件中,可以使用以下语法:
Disallow /old-page/
这表示禁止访问 `/old-page/` 以下所有页面。
在网页开发中,disallow 还可用于设置 URL 重定向规则,例如:
Redirect 301 /old-page/ http://new-domain.com/
这表示将 `/old-page/` 重定向到新域名。
此外,在前端开发中,disallow 也用于限制用户访问某些页面,例如:
if (userIsNotAdmin)
disallowAccessToPage('/admin');
这表示在用户不是管理员的情况下,禁止访问 `/admin` 页面。
三、disallow 在搜索引擎优化(SEO)中的作用
在 SEO 中,disallow 用于控制搜索引擎是否收录某些网页内容。例如,在网站的 `.htaccess` 文件中,可以设置:
RewriteRule ^old-page$ /new-page/ [R=301,L]
这表示将 `/old-page/` 重定向到 `/new-page/`,同时禁止搜索引擎收录 `/old-page/` 页面。
另外,在搜索引擎优化中,disallow 也用于排除某些页面,避免其被收录。例如:
Disallow /deprecated/
这表示禁止收录 `/deprecated/` 以下所有页面。
四、disallow 的技术实现方式
在技术实现中,disallow 通常通过服务器配置文件(如 `.htaccess` 或 `robots.txt` 文件)来设置。在 `.htaccess` 文件中,可以使用以下语法:
Disallow /old-page/
这表示禁止访问 `/old-page/` 以下所有页面。
在 `robots.txt` 文件中,可以设置:
User-agent:
Disallow: /old-page/
这表示所有搜索引擎都禁止访问 `/old-page/` 页面。
此外,在前端开发中,disallow 也可以通过 JavaScript 或服务器端代码实现。例如,在服务器端,可以使用如下的伪代码:
if (request.path == '/old-page/')
disallowAccessToPage('/old-page/');
这表示在用户访问 `/old-page/` 时,禁止访问该页面。
五、disallow 在 SEO 中的实际应用
在 SEO 中,disallow 用于控制搜索引擎是否收录某些网页内容。例如,在网站的 `.htaccess` 文件中,可以设置:
RewriteRule ^old-page$ /new-page/ [R=301,L]
这表示将 `/old-page/` 重定向到 `/new-page/`,同时禁止搜索引擎收录 `/old-page/` 页面。
此外,在 SEO 中,disallow 也用于排除某些页面,避免其被收录。例如:
Disallow /deprecated/
这表示禁止收录 `/deprecated/` 以下所有页面。
六、disallow 的实际应用场景
在实际应用中,disallow 广泛用于以下几个场景:
1. 网页开发:设置服务器规则,控制网页内容的访问权限。
2. SEO 优化:排除某些页面,避免其被收录。
3. 网站维护:清理旧页面,避免重复内容。
4. 用户体验:限制用户访问某些页面,提升网站安全性。
例如,一个电商网站可能会设置:
Disallow /old-products/
以禁止搜索引擎收录旧的促销页面,避免影响搜索排名。
七、disallow 的常见误区与注意事项
在使用 disallow 时,需要注意以下几个常见误区:
1. 误用路径:在设置 `Disallow` 时,路径必须准确无误,否则会导致页面被错误地排除。
2. 忽略重定向:在设置 `Disallow` 时,需注意重定向规则,避免因重定向导致页面被错误排除。
3. 忽略权限控制:在网页开发中,`Disallow` 不能替代权限控制,应结合前端 JavaScript 或服务器端代码进行管理。
4. 忽略 SEO 优化:在 SEO 优化中,`Disallow` 只是控制搜索引擎的手段,不能替代内容质量的提升。
八、disallow 的未来发展趋势
随着互联网技术的发展,disallow 在网页开发、SEO 优化和网站维护中仍将发挥重要作用。未来,随着人工智能和自动化工具的普及,disallow 的使用将更加智能化,例如:
- 自动识别并排除重复内容
- 智能推荐排除页面
- 通过机器学习优化搜索引擎的收录策略
同时,随着用户隐私和数据安全的提升,disallow 也将更多地用于数据保护和内容过滤,防止敏感信息被滥用。
九、总结
disallow 是一个重要的技术术语,广泛应用于网页开发、SEO 优化和网站维护中。它在控制网页访问权限、排除搜索引擎收录和提升用户体验等方面发挥着关键作用。在实际应用中,需要注意路径的准确性、重定向规则的设置以及权限控制的结合使用。随着技术的发展,disallow 将继续在互联网领域中扮演重要角色。
十、
在互联网时代,disallow 是一个不可或缺的关键词。无论是网页开发、SEO 优化,还是网站维护,它都扮演着重要的角色。通过合理使用 disallow,可以提升网站的用户体验、优化搜索引擎排名,同时确保网站的安全性和稳定性。在未来,随着技术的不断进步,disallow 的应用将更加广泛和深入。
推荐文章
781355的含义:解码数字背后的深层逻辑在数字世界中,781355是一个看似普通的数字组合,但它背后隐藏着复杂的逻辑与文化意义。从字面意义到深层象征,从历史背景到现代应用,781355的含义远不止于简单的数字排列。本文将从多个维度解
2026-04-08 14:39:32
306人看过
874157的含义:解析数字编码背后的逻辑与文化内涵在现代社会中,数字的使用早已超越了简单的计数功能,成为信息传递、技术应用和文化表达的重要工具。其中,“874157”作为一个由数字组成的字符串,其含义往往取决于具体语境。本文将从数字
2026-04-08 14:39:32
90人看过
23510652的含义23510652是一个由数字组成的序列,其含义在不同领域和情境下可能有所差异。通常来说,这个数字组合可以被解读为一种编码、一种标识,或是某种特定情境下的编号。在不同的应用场景中,23510652可能代表不同的信息
2026-04-08 14:39:13
89人看过
991437的含义:解析数字背后的文化与技术密码在数字世界中,991437是一个看似无厘头的组合,却在不同领域中承载着独特意义。它既是某种编码,也是某种文化符号,甚至在技术层面具有一定的功能性。本文将从多个维度深入解读991437的含
2026-04-08 14:38:43
348人看过



